Quality Inspector & Coordinate Measuring Machine (CMM) Operator
Pay: $20/hour+ DOE
Location: Tulsa, OK
Hours: Monday–Friday, 6:00 AM – 4:00 PM (hours may vary)
Job Type: Temp-to-Perm
Position Overview:
We are seeking an experienced Quality Inspector & CMM Operator to support manufacturing operations by conducting First Article, in-process, and final inspections. This role is also responsible for the operation and maintenance of the Zeiss G2 CMM machine. The ideal candidate will be detail-oriented, quality-focused, and capable of making informed acceptance or rejection decisions based on engineering specifications.
Primary Responsibilities:
- Perform First Article, in-process, and final inspections using standard measuring equipment.
- Document inspection results accurately and control the identification and location of nonconforming products.
- Log time and job details using JobBoss software.
- Prioritize inspection workload to support production schedules and minimize delays.
- Collaborate with production personnel to resolve quality issues in real time.
- Operate and maintain the Zeiss G2 CMM machine and interpret GD&T and Catia annotations.
Essential Functions & Technical Skills:
- Proficient in blueprint reading and interpretation.
- Knowledge of GD&T (Geometric Dimensioning & Tolerancing).
- Familiarity with Calypso software (preferred).
- Understanding of Catia-annotation systems.
- Strong computer skills, including Microsoft Word and Excel.
- Ability to perform layout inspections using SME tools.
- Experience working within an AS9100 quality management system.
- Exposure to an effective calibration system.
- Hands-on experience in CMM operations and/or certification.
CMM-Specific Duties:
- Ensure precision machinery is maintained and calibrated.
- Determine programming requirements based on design specifications.
- Operate and maintain precision measurement equipment.
Qualifications & Requirements:
- High school diploma or equivalent (required).
- Minimum of 2 years of inspection and blueprint reading experience in a manufacturing environment.
- Minimum of 2 years of CMM operation and/or programming experience.
- CMM operation/programming certification (required).
- Post-secondary education may substitute for experience.
- NDT Level I, II, or III (preferred but not required).
- Weld Inspector certification (preferred but not required).
Physical & Environmental Requirements:
- Must be able to lift up to 50 lbs unassisted.
- Ability to stand and move throughout the facility while performing inspections.
